Installation

Ensure the refrigerator is placed on a level surface and has adequate ventilation.

  1. Remove packaging materials and inspect for damage.
  2. Connect the water supply line if applicable.
  3. Plug into a grounded electrical outlet.
  4. Adjust the leveling legs as needed.

WARNING! Ensure proper clearance around the refrigerator for airflow.

First-Time Setup

Power on the refrigerator and set the desired temperature.

  1. Press the power button to turn on the unit.
  2. Set the refrigerator and freezer temperatures using the control panel.
  3. Allow the refrigerator to cool for several hours before adding food.

CAUTION! Do not overload the refrigerator during the initial cooling period.

Connecting Water Supply

Follow these steps to connect the refrigerator to a water supply.

  1. Locate the water supply valve.
  2. Connect the water line to the refrigerator's inlet valve.
  3. Turn on the water supply and check for leaks.

Tip: Use a water filter for improved water quality.

Maintenance and Care

Regular maintenance ensures optimal performance.

  1. Clean the exterior with a soft cloth.
  2. Check and clean the condenser coils every six months.
  3. Replace water filters as recommended.

CAUTION! Unplug the refrigerator before performing maintenance.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Refrigerator not coolingPower supply issueCheck the power connection and circuit breaker.
Water dispenser not workingClogged filterReplace the water filter.
Ice maker not producing iceWater supply issueEnsure water line is connected and valve is open.
Noise from refrigeratorImproper levelingAdjust the leveling legs.
